Maja Ruznic "Who Tastes Fire and Cannot Speak"

Contemporary Fine Arts, Totengässlein 5, 4051 Basel
To coincide with Art Basel, Contemporary Fine Arts presents "Who Tastes Fire and Cannot Speak", the first solo exhibition of artist Maja Ruznic at the Basel gallery.
Contemporary Fine Arts is pleased to present "Who Tastes Fire and Cannot Speak", the first solo exhibition of Bosnia and Herzegovina-born, New Mexico-based artist Maja Ruznic at the Basel gallery. Ruznic explores how paintings can create a space for the subconscious and the unsaid. Her works situate emotions and traumas within the body and in architectural metaphors, where elusiveness and asymmetry reflect a constant realignment of the psyche. The exhibition connects her personal experiences of fleeing the Bosnian War with universal themes of displacement and highlights how language reaches its limits. This creates a space in which darkness is part of the equilibrium, silence conveys knowledge, and the canvases deliberately refrain from offering simple answers.
